How much do senior java software eng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 26,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ior java software engineer in Manchester, NH is $150,284.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$124,500.00 and $163,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a senior Java software engineer do?

A Senior Java Software Engineer is respon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ining complex software applications using the Java programming language. They often lead technical projects, mentor junior developers, and collaborate with cross-functional teams to deliver high-quality software solutions. Their role includes analyzing user requirements, troubleshooting issues, optimizing code for performance, and ensuring best practices in software development. Senior Java engineers are also involved in code reviews and may contribute to architectural decisions within their organization.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ior Java software engineer?

To thrive as a Senior Java Software Engineer, you need advanced proficiency in Java programming, software design principles, and a solid understanding of computer science fundamentals, often backed by a degree in computer science or a related field. Experience with frameworks like Spring, build tools such as Maven or Gradle, and version control systems like Git is typically required, along with knowledge of cloud platforms or containerization tools.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and leadership skills help you mentor team members and collaborate on complex projects. These competencies are crucial for delivering robust, scalable software solutions and leading development teams in dynamic environments.

What are some common challenges faced by senior Java software engineers when leading development projects?

Senior Java Software Engineers often encounter challenges such as balancing hands-on coding with leading and mentoring team members, managing tight project deadlines, and ensuring code quality across the team. They are also responsible for making key architectural decisions and integrating new technologies while maintaining system stability. Effective communication and collaboration with cross-functional teams, including QA, DevOps, and product managers, are essential to successfully deliver robust solutions.

Job description

KAYAK, part of Booking Holdings (NASDAQ: BKNG), is the world’s leading travel search engine. With billions of queries across our platforms, we help people find their perfect flight, stay, rental car and vacation package. We’re also transforming business travel with a new corporate travel solution, KAYAK for Business.

As an employee of KAYAK, you will be part of a travel company that operates a portfolio of global metasearch brands including momondo, Cheapflights and HotelsCombined, among others. From start-up to industry leader, innovation is in our DNA and every employee has an opportunity to make their mark. Our focus is on building the best travel search engine to make it easier for everyone to experience the world.

We are looking for a strong Senior Java Software Engineer to implement new features and maintain KAYAK’s world-leading platform. We are seeking for people who love working with data - parsing, analyzing, investigating, interpreting, modeling, and extracting knowledge from large volumes of data. Good candidates will have a passion in processing data to help drive better business decisions or to develop new features, in a fast-paced environment where many small and diverse projects are the norm.

This role will be required to work from our Concord, MA office at least 3 days per week.

In this role, you will:
  • Extract data from databases, write scripts to parse, clean, combine, and process them

  • Communicate with APIs via REST or SOAP interfaces.

  • Configure enterprise applications for large customers.

  • Develop tools to assist in the debugging of existing products.

  • Build and maintain high-performance integrations with third-party APIs (airlines, hotel and rentalcars providers)

  • Take full ownership of your designs: from initial concept to deployment while maintaining high standards for code quality and performance

  • Participate in code reviews and architectural steering to ensure the K4B project remains modular and reusable as KAYAK expands its enterprise footprint

Please apply if you have:
  • +6-8 years of experience with Java programming

  • Strong understanding of programming fundamentals, data structures, algorithms, and software design

  • Ability to work independently and with a team

  • Good communication skills for sharing ideas clearly with both technical and non-technical colleagues

  • Experience with relational databases like MySQL or Oracle

  • Prior experience in the travel domain is beneficial

  • Experience with B2B systems or identity/HR integrations is beneficial — e.g., SCIM, SAML/OAuth, SSO, user provisioning/deprovisioning, and connecting HRIS/IDP platforms (Workday, Okta, Active Directory) to product services.

  • Experience with the following:

    • Unix shell scripting

    • Spring & Mybatis frameworks

    • DOM and using XPath, JQuery & CSS

    • API development using REST, Web Service, SOAP, etc

    • Machine Learning
